[cairo-commit] rcairo ChangeLog,1.236,1.237 Rakefile,1.7,1.8
Kouhei Sutou
commit at pdx.freedesktop.org
Fri Apr 11 05:38:36 PDT 2008
Committed by: kou
Update of /cvs/cairo/rcairo
In directory kemper:/tmp/cvs-serv5712
Modified Files:
ChangeLog Rakefile
Log Message:
* Rakefile: fix dependencies.
Index: ChangeLog
===================================================================
RCS file: /cvs/cairo/rcairo/ChangeLog,v
retrieving revision 1.236
retrieving revision 1.237
diff -u -d -r1.236 -r1.237
--- ChangeLog 11 Apr 2008 12:20:23 -0000 1.236
+++ ChangeLog 11 Apr 2008 12:43:25 -0000 1.237
@@ -1,6 +1,8 @@
2008-04-11 Kouhei Sutou <kou at cozmixng.org>
- * Rakefile: follow the recent Hoe's changes.
+ * Rakefile:
+ - follow the recent Hoe's changes.
+ - fix dependencies.
* src/rb_cairo_surface.c: implemented Cairo::PSSurface#eps?.
Index: Rakefile
===================================================================
RCS file: /cvs/cairo/rcairo/Rakefile,v
retrieving revision 1.7
retrieving revision 1.8
diff -u -d -r1.7 -r1.8
--- Rakefile 11 Apr 2008 12:20:23 -0000 1.7
+++ Rakefile 11 Apr 2008 12:43:25 -0000 1.8
@@ -1,5 +1,4 @@
-# -*- coding: utf-8 -*-
-# -*- ruby -*-
+# -*- coding: utf-8; mode: ruby -*-
require 'English'
@@ -136,11 +135,11 @@
doc_title_image = File.join(doc_dir, "rcairo-title.png")
task(doc_index).instance_variable_get("@actions").clear
-file doc_index => doc_dir do
+file doc_dir do
mkdir_p doc_dir
end
-file doc_title_image => rcairo_doc_title_image do
+file doc_title_image => [doc_dir, rcairo_doc_title_image] do
cp rcairo_doc_title_image, doc_title_image
end
@@ -181,9 +180,13 @@
end
langs.each do |lang,|
- lang_doc_index = File.join(doc_dir, lang, "index.html")
+ lang_doc_dir = File.join(doc_dir, lang)
+ file lang_doc_dir do
+ mkdir_p lang_doc_dir
+ end
+ lang_doc_index = File.join(lang_doc_dir, "index.html")
task doc_index => lang_doc_index
- file lang_doc_index do
+ file lang_doc_index => [lang_doc_dir] do
lang_doc_dir = File.join(doc_dir, lang)
lang_rcairo_doc_dir = File.join(rcairo_doc_dir, lang)
mkdir_p lang_doc_dir
More information about the cairo-commit
mailing list